The postcode S66 8BD is located in Rotherham, in the county of South Yorksh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. S66 8BD is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

S66 8BD is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 5.2 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of S66 8BD as Hard-pressed living > Hard pressed ageing workers > Ageing industrious workers.

The closest road name to S66 8BD is Hazel Road which is centered 49 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Addison Road/Maple Avenue and is 104 m away.

The closest primary school to S66 8BD (for ages 11 and under) is Maltby Lilly Hall Academy.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on September 29, 2021.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Wickersley School and Sports College.

The local pub for residents of S66 8BD is Crookhill Park Golf Club and is 4.77 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on April 2, 2019. The nearest takeaway food is available from Mr Khan's Indian Takeaway and is 5.76 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on September 18, 2018.

Residents reported an average download speed of 62.5 Mbps and an average upload speed of 10.6 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 21.1%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.8 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for S66 8BD is covered by the South Yorkshire police force association and Rotherham is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
